Manchester City U21 secured a commanding 3-0 victory over Norwich City U21 in an English U21 Premier League fixture that kicked off at 02:00 on April 14, 2026. The comprehensive win at City's academy ground saw the young Sky Blues dominate from the outset, putting in a clinical performance to take all three points. The home side opened the scoring midway through the first half with a well-worked team goal, before doubling their advantage just before halftime with a powerful finish from inside the box. The second half continued in the same vein, with Manchester City U21 adding a third goal to seal the result, capitalizing on a Norwich defensive error. The match was a showcase of Manchester City's famed youth development, with several players displaying technical prowess and tactical discipline. The result provided a significant boost to Manchester City U21's position in the league table, while Norwich City U21 were left to reflect on a difficult away performance where they struggled to create clear chances.
